** The Volkswagen repair market for a resident of Bob White, WV, is characterized by limited *local* options but supported by a few high-quality regional specialists. Due to the rural nature of Boone County, owners of modern, complex Volkswagens (especially those with TDI, DSG, 4MOTION, or EV systems) cannot rely on general mechanics and must seek out these specialized shops. **Average Quality:** The quality of the specialized shops is very high, often exceeding that of the nearest dealerships, which are a significant drive away. These specialists thrive because of their targeted expertise. **Competition Level:** Competition among true VW specialists is low within the immediate area, but the shops listed compete for the broader regional customer base. Their reputation is their primary marketing tool.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is competitive for specialized European auto repair. Labor rates are typically between $110 - $140 per hour, which is below dealership rates but above those of general repair shops. Customers are paying for specific tooling, proprietary software access, and technician training that general shops lack.
